Teachers use a variety of techniques to check that students are following along with the direct instruction or activity.
Types of “Checks”:
Thumbs Up/Down
Post-it to write down question or answer and stick on poster board before exiting classroom
Google Form
ABCD options on desk to answer displayed question
Teacher asks the class if they understand/asks a comprehension question.
Student verbally responds to demonstrate understanding/responds adequately to the comprehension question.
“Before you leave the room, write down one thing we saw in class that you still need help understanding.”
Students jot down anything they are struggling with in class. If students have a full understanding of the material, they can write down something they learned.
Students will write names on the back of the post-it for privacy.
